scrivo questo post per riuscire, se possibile, a sistemare un problemino che credo interessi molti nefiti ASPisti come me.

il problema è la gestione della root nei vari siti con ISS 5.1: mi spiego meglio.

se ci si trova a lavorare con X siti, nella cartella wwwroot non è possibile mettere tutti i files di tutti gli X siti, sparpagliati. ne esce un casino.

la situazione più logica è naturalmente quella di creare una cartella per ogni sito, così da dividere tutti i lavori. e qui il problema:

nella fase di pubblicazione infatti può succedere che, ad esempio per pagine all'interno di sottocartelle (/lavoro1/sottocartella/), una stringa del tipo:
codice:
DB_PATH= "../database/database.mdb"
non venga riconosciuta da ISS 6.0. a questo punto, togliendo i "..", la pagina funziona su iss6.0 ma non su iss 5.1..

ora, e qui la domanda: esiste un modo per configurare ISS 5.1 in modo che OGNI CARTELLA venga riconsciuta come una root a se stante, percui se entro nella cartella "lavoro1", da ASP la root di questo sito sia lavoro1 e non wwwroot/lavoro1?